6. Question
Statement:
T > S, P = Q, S> R, Q ≤ R
Conclusion:
I). R = T
II). Q < T
P = Q ≤ R < S < T
I) R = T – False
II) Q < T – True
So Only Conclusion II follows
7. Question
Statement:
M > N, P < O, O < N, Q > P
Conclusion:
I). M > P
II). N < Q
M > N > O > P < Q
I) M > P – True
II) N < Q–False
So Only Conclusion I follows
8. Question
Statements:
S ≤ B = C < D; D ≤ U = Q < N < Y
Conclusions:
I). S < Q
II). U < Y
S ≤ B = C < D; D ≤ U = Q < N < Y
I) S < Q (S ≤ B = C < D ≤ U = Q)–>True
II) U < Y (U = Q < N < Y)–> True
So, both the conclusion are follows.
9. Question
Statements:
S ≤ T > U < V = W; K > I > U = M
Conclusions:
I). W > M
II). I > S
S ≤ T > U < V = W; K > I > U = M
I) W > M (M =U < V = W)–>True
II) I > S (S ≤ T > U < I > )–>False
So, the conclusion I follows.
10. Question
Statements:
M = N ≤ O < P ≥ S > X ≥ Y = U
Conclusions:
I). M < S
II). U < P
M = N ≤ O < P ≥ S > X ≥ Y = U
I) M < S (M = N ≤ O < P ≥ S)–>False
II) U < P (P ≥ S > X ≥ Y = U)–>True
So, the conclusion II follows.
